Embedded Software Engineer Interview Question:
Explain various uses of timers in embedded system?
Submitted by: MuhammadTimers in embedded system are used in multiple ways
☛ Real Time Clock (RTC) for the system
☛ Initiating an event after a preset time delay
☛ Initiating an even after a comparison of preset times
☛ Capturing the count value in timer on an event
☛ Between two events finding the time interval
☛ Time slicing for various tasks
☛ Time division multiplexing
☛ Scheduling of various tasks in RTOS
